1. About Dispute Prevention & Pre-Litigation Law in Curitiba, Brazil

Dispute prevention and pre-litigation in Curitiba focus on resolving conflicts before filing court actions. The core tools are negotiation, conciliation and mediation, often facilitated by court programs known as CEJUS - Centro Judiciário de Soluções de Conflitos e Cidadania. These processes aim to save time and costs while preserving business or personal relationships.

In Curitiba, as in the rest of Brazil, the national framework drives pre-litigation steps, with local courts offering mediation centers and conciliation sessions. When effective, pre-litigation outcomes can include formal settlements, binding agreements or memoranda of understanding that avoid lengthy court battles. Importantly, the law supports and sometimes requires these processes before proceeding to litigation in many civil matters.

Key idea to remember: Pre-litigation does not replace legal rights, it offers structured avenues to resolve disputes quickly and predictably with formal oversight from courts and legal professionals. This approach is especially relevant for Curitiba's active commercial, real estate and consumer sectors. Conciliação e Mediação resources provide practical paths for residents seeking early resolution.

Conciliação e Mediação são instrumentos previstos na Lei 13.140/2015 para a solução de conflitos sem litígio.

For Curitibanos facing cross-border or intra-state disputes, the local practice integrates national rules with municipal and court-level implementations. This combination helps align expectations, timelines and costs from the outset of any dispute. Guidance from a qualified attorney ensures compliance with formal requirements and maximizes the chance of an efficient resolution.

2. Why You May Need a Lawyer

Curitiba residents often face conflicts where pre-litigation counsel adds clarity and leverage. Below are concrete scenarios where a dispute prevention or pre-litigation lawyer can make a meaningful difference.

  • Contract breach between a Curitiba manufacturer and a supplier - A local textile company discovers delayed shipments and quality issues. A lawyer helps prepare a structured pre-litigation mediation request to preserve the supply relationship while seeking concrete remedies and timeframes for cure.
  • Consumer dispute with a Curitiba service provider - A resident challenges improper billing from a local telecom firm. A legal advisor guides a formal conciliation request, aiming for a binding settlement without court action.
  • Real estate transaction with latent defects in a Curitiba neighborhood - A buyer and builder attempt mediated settlement to address defective work and compensations before any lawsuit, saving both time and costs.
  • Construction project disputes with a developer in Curitiba - A condo association seeks to resolve warranty claims and repair timelines through a pre-litigation mediation process with the developer, under CEJUS oversight.
  • Commercial lease disputes in central Curitiba - Landlords and tenants pursue a pre-litigation conciliation to adjust rent terms, reimbursements, and renewal options without court involvement.
  • Municipal service disputes - A small business challenges a city service charge or permit denial and uses pre-litigation channels to negotiate a settlement that avoids a formal lawsuit.

In each scenario, engaging a lawyer early helps ensure the right process is used, documents are prepared properly, and the settlement terms are enforceable. A lawyer also coordinates with the CEJUS process and ensures procedural deadlines are met.

3. Local Laws Overview

Brazilian dispute prevention and pre-litigation principles are anchored in national law, which Curitiba administers through its courts. The key statutes that govern mediation and pre-litigation include:

  • Lei nº 13.140, de 26 de junho de 2015 - Lei de Mediação. This law formalizes mediation as a recognized path to conflict resolution and outlines the roles of mediators, parties and attorneys. It is applicable nationwide, including Curitiba, and supports voluntary or court-mushed mediation agreements. Lei 13.140/2015 - Lei de Mediação (Planalto).
  • Lei nº 13.105, de 16 de março de 2015 - Código de Processo Civil (CPC 2015). This reformulated framework places clear emphasis on conciliation and mediation prior to protracted litigation and sets out procedural steps for pre-litigation attempts. Its entry into force occurred in 2016, shaping Curitiba’s court practices. Lei 13.105/2015 - CPC.
  • Resolução CNJ 125/2010 - Políticas Judiciárias de Conciliação, Mediação e Observância de Conflitos. This resolution encouraged courts to establish CEJUS and emphasize alternative dispute resolution. (Official CNJ guidance; see government resources for translations and summaries).

Recent trends in Curitiba include expanded CEJUS availability, more online mediation options and streamlined pre-litigation forms for small and medium enterprises. These changes reflect a national shift toward faster settlements and reduced court dockets. For authoritative overviews, consult official government resources on mediation and the CPC.

Useful sources: Lei 13.140/2015, Lei 13.105/2015, Conciliação e Mediação - gov.br.

4. Frequently Asked Questions

What is the role of a dispute prevention lawyer in Curitiba?

A dispute prevention lawyer guides you through conciliation and mediation options. They prepare documents, assess risk, and help you select the best resolution path, with emphasis on enforceable settlements.

How does mediation work before a civil lawsuit in Curitiba?

A mediator facilitates discussions between parties to reach a voluntary agreement. If successful, the settlement can be binding and enforced by the courts if embedded in a formal agreement.

When should I involve a lawyer in pre-litigation in Curitiba?

In complex contracts or where large sums are at stake, involve a lawyer early. They ensure your rights are protected and the pre-litigation steps comply with CPC 2015 and the mediation law.

Where can I access free pre-litigation mediation in Curitiba?

Public CEJUS centers in Curitiba provide access to mediation services. A lawyer can help you navigate eligibility and prepare the necessary mediation requests.

Why is pre-litigation important for small businesses in Curitiba?

Pre-litigation reduces court costs and downtime, preserves business relationships, and creates documented settlements that are easier to enforce than ad hoc agreements.

Can I start a mediation without a lawyer in Curitiba?

Yes, mediation can proceed without a lawyer, but a lawyer can improve preparation, protect legal rights, and help craft a durable agreement and enforcement plan.

Should I sign a pre-litigation settlement in Curitiba?

Only after careful review by counsel. Ensure the terms are precise, include remedies, timelines, and a mechanism to address future disputes without re-litigation.

Do I need to pay fees for pre-litigation mediation in Curitiba?

Fees vary by provider and case type. Some public programs offer reduced costs or waivers; a lawyer can outline expected costs and potential savings.

Is the pre-litigation process faster than going to court in Curitiba?

Generally yes. Many disputes settle within weeks rather than months or years in litigation, especially for routine commercial or consumer issues.

What is CEJUS and how does it operate in Curitiba?

CEJUS is a court-led program that coordinates mediation and conciliation sessions. In Curitiba, it helps structure disputes for early resolution and documents settlements for enforcement.

How long does a pre-litigation mediation typically take in Curitiba?

Sessions may occur within 2-6 weeks of filing a request, depending on the case complexity and mediator availability. Complex matters can extend to 2-3 months.

What are the typical costs of pre-litigation services in Curitiba?

Costs depend on the provider and case type; public programs may be low-cost or free, while private mediators charge per hour or per session with a cap.

6. Next Steps

  1. Identify the dispute type and objective for pre-litigation - define what you want to achieve (settlement terms, timelines, remedies). Set a realistic timetable for resolution.
  2. Find Curitiba CEJUS options and confirm eligibility for pre-litigation mediation through official channels. Gather all relevant documents (contracts, invoices, communications).
  3. Consult a dispute prevention lawyer early to assess your rights and prepare a pre-litigation package. Obtain a clear fee estimate and expected timelines.
  4. Prepare a concise mediation brief and list of requested remedies, including fallback positions if mediation fails. Share these with the mediator and opposing party.
  5. Submit the mediation request to the appropriate CEJUS or mediator and schedule a session. Ensure all deadlines and prerequisites are met.
  6. Attend the mediation with your lawyer, keep notes, and aim for a written settlement reflecting agreed terms. If needed, request a follow-up session for further refinement.
  7. If no settlement is reached, discuss with your lawyer the timeline and steps to prepare for formal litigation, ensuring all pre-litigation requirements were followed.
